4-Day Nature Itinerary in Kasol in June 2023

  1. Day 1: Parvati River
    15 minutes (3.5 km) from Kasol

    Start the day with a peaceful walk along the Parvati River. You can admire the scenic beauty of the river and the lush greenery surrounding it. After a relaxing morning walk, you can try some local street food at the nearby stalls. In the afternoon, go for a dip in the river to beat the heat. In the evening, sit by the river and watch the beautiful sunset.

  2. Day 2: Malana Village
    1 hour 10 minutes (21.4 km) from Kasol

    Malana Village is known for its unique culture and beautiful surroundings. Start your day early and trek to the village. On the way, enjoy the scenic beauty of the lush green mountains. In the village, you can interact with the locals and try some local food. You can also learn about the unique culture of the village. In the afternoon, trek back to Kasol and enjoy some local delicacies at the cafes.

  3. Day 3: Kheerganga Trek
    1 hour 20 minutes (22.7 km) from Kasol

    Embark on the beautiful Kheerganga Trek early in the morning. The trek is known for its scenic beauty and natural hot springs. On the way, enjoy the lush greenery and beautiful views. Once you reach the top, take a dip in the natural hot springs to relax and rejuvenate. In the evening, enjoy the beautiful sunset and have dinner at the top. You can stay in the camps at the top.

  4. Day 4: Tosh Village
    50 minutes (18.7 km) from Kasol

    Start the day early and trek to the beautiful Tosh Village. The village is known for its beautiful views and unique culture. On the way, enjoy the beautiful mountainous terrain. In the village, you can interact with the locals and try some local food. In the afternoon, trek back to Kasol and enjoy some local delicacies at the cafes. Spend the evening exploring the local markets and picking up some souvenirs.

Recommendations

Some other local attractions you can visit include the Manikaran Sahib Gurudwara, the Tirthan Valley, and the Great Himalayan National Park. You can also take a side trip to the nearby villages of Jari and Pulga. To maximize your fun, make sure to carry comfortable walking shoes, sunscreen, and insect repellent. Finally, make sure to keep a day or two extra in your itinerary to account for any unforeseen delays or bad weather.

Time and Costs Estimates

  • Parvati River (2 hours, Free)
  • Malana Village Trek (8 hours, Free)
  • Kheerganga Trek (12 hours, approximately INR 1000)
  • Tosh Village Trek (6 hours, Free)
  • Total Estimated Costs: approximately INR 1000
